the coin has been mishandled in the past showing either finger or palm prints. I'm not into toned coins as in a lot of cases dont age well. this one is not bad. strike is correct for the year. you have some scuffs and scratches on the fields on both sides and the elephant in the room is the reeding on the cheek, which coinfrog commented on, is in a key area which has more of an effect on grade. technically MS64 however, with the hit and finger/palm prints, I would net it to MS63
